Remote sensing plays a critical role in enabling robots to navigate and interact effectively with their environment. It involves the use of sensors and technologies that gather data about the surroundings without direct physical contact. By utilizing remote sensing, robots can detect obstacles, identify terrain types, and assess environmental conditions, which are essential for safe and efficient navigation.

This ability to perceive the environment allows robots to make informed decisions and adjust their actions accordingly. For instance, a robot equipped with remote sensing capabilities can map its surroundings, recognize objects, and understand spatial relationships, facilitating better movement and interaction with other entities in the environment.
